数据库 · 2 11 月, 2024

帶您了解DB2快照監控

帶您了解DB2快照監控

在當今的數據驅動時代,數據庫的性能監控變得越來越重要。IBM的DB2數據庫系統是一個廣泛使用的關係數據庫管理系統,特別是在企業環境中。DB2快照監控是一種有效的工具,幫助管理員監控數據庫的性能,及時發現潛在的問題。本文將深入探討DB2快照監控的概念、功能及其實施方法。

什麼是DB2快照監控?

DB2快照監控是一種性能監控技術,通過定期收集數據庫的快照來評估其運行狀態。這些快照包含了有關數據庫性能的關鍵指標,如CPU使用率、內存使用情況、I/O操作、鎖定情況等。通過分析這些快照,數據庫管理員可以識別性能瓶頸,並採取相應的措施來優化數據庫的運行。

DB2快照監控的主要功能

  • 性能評估:快照監控可以幫助管理員評估數據庫的整體性能,了解系統在不同時間段的運行狀況。
  • 問題診斷:通過分析快照數據,管理員可以快速定位性能問題的根源,例如查詢執行緩慢或資源使用不均衡。
  • 趨勢分析:長期收集快照數據可以幫助管理員識別性能趨勢,從而為未來的資源規劃提供依據。
  • 自動化報告:DB2支持自動生成性能報告,幫助管理員定期檢查系統狀態。

如何實施DB2快照監控

實施DB2快照監控的過程相對簡單,以下是一些基本步驟:

1. 啟用快照監控

首先,您需要在DB2數據庫中啟用快照監控功能。這可以通過DB2命令行界面執行以下命令來完成:

UPDATE DATABASE CONFIGURATION USING MONITORING ON

2. 設定快照間隔

接下來,您可以設定快照的收集間隔。這可以根據系統的需求進行調整,通常建議每隔幾分鐘收集一次快照。使用以下命令設定快照間隔:

UPDATE DATABASE CONFIGURATION USING SNAPSHOT INTERVAL 5

3. 收集和分析快照數據

一旦快照監控啟用並設定好,DB2將自動收集快照數據。您可以使用以下命令查看當前的快照數據:

SELECT * FROM SYSIBM.SNAPDB

這將返回有關數據庫性能的詳細信息,您可以根據這些數據進行分析。

4. 定期檢查和優化

最後,管理員應定期檢查快照數據,並根據分析結果進行必要的優化。例如,您可能需要調整查詢、增加索引或升級硬件資源。

結論

DB2快照監控是一個強大的工具,能夠幫助數據庫管理員有效地監控和優化數據庫性能。通過定期收集和分析快照數據,管理員可以及時發現問題並採取行動,從而確保數據庫的穩定運行。對於希望提升數據庫性能的企業來說,實施DB2快照監控無疑是一個明智的選擇。

如果您對於如何在您的環境中實施DB2快照監控有進一步的興趣,或是需要更多有關香港VPS雲伺服器的資訊,歡迎訪問我們的網站以獲取更多資源。